> Hi, Here's what I got from ABISee support on the flash issue under zoomX.
Hope it helps, > Hi Erik, > > To turn the light On/Off please use Ctrl+L. It will work only when camera is > active. > So, press the space bar first, you'll hear : 'Camera started', then Ctrl+L. > You'll hear: 'Light on'. > Works the same way for Windows and Mac. > > Best regards, > > Ilana > > erik burggraaf wrote: >> Hi Ilana, Do you have an answer for this?
